    Hey all,

    I know there are some of you who haven't had a chance to play the game yet but I figured I'd make a post where we could discuss our personal strenghts (and weaknesses) from a group standpoint (as opposed to the solo topic already posted here).

    So if you were part of a criminal team (which is currently at a max of 4) what would be your specialty, job, strengths, ect.?


    Lupus
    Primary Weapon of Choice: Assault Rifle (N-Tec/AK-47)
    Secondary Weapon of Choice: Machine Pistol
    Favorite Role: Assault Specialist
    Secondary Role(s): Driver/Support

    For me, I preform best at a medium range because from there I can rush forward if my opponent is using a long-range rifle, fall back if they are using a shotgun or submachine gun, and provide adaquate support to my teammates from a healthy distance.

    I am a very adabtable jack-of-all-trades and I am pretty good with any weapon and can therefore fill almost any spot on a team, but I also don't really *excell* at any weapon in particular. I'm never really suprised when I'm beat out by someone who's used a single gun their entire time playing.

    When I'm running with a team, I really like to be a getaway driver (which I think I'm pretty good at) or provide backup around an objective. Ambushes are fun and I feel my adaptability extends to predicting an enemies movements pretty well.
    Of course, if I'm wrong an ambush can quickly turn on me.

    Hey, this is pretty neat. Here's my character.

    Jess
    Primary Weapon of Choice: Sniper Rifle
    Secondary Weapon of Choice: Machine Pistol
    Favorite Role: Sniper, Ranged Support/Communication
    Secondary Role(s): Driver

    I do fairly well at sniping and driving. I've had limited success with the SMG and NONE with Shotguns, so I just stick to what I know I'm good at, sniping. In addition, though I think I'm a pretty good driver in APB, the silliness of not losing any accuracy with a rifle while hanging out of the window of a speeding car makes me more valuable as a gunner when in a car rather than a driver. Not to mention, Sniper Rifles dish out so much damage they're fairly good against vehicles in a chase at distances.
